Output 123ca3109422a96d88528d1bd29d89c8361060eb38e5e6db47ae1f21d95eab29:0

value
53627984
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cf4294f1a703cbb39a40baddf7d7a0bd4eb0c59 OP_EQUALVERIFY OP_CHECKSIG
address
1CPhHR86TzQTChNSi4uTsWNrropf3WX7S3
transaction
123ca3109422a96d88528d1bd29d89c8361060eb38e5e6db47ae1f21d95eab29
spent
true